Gyumri, the second largest city of Armenia, is still recovering from the disastrous earthquake of 1988. Life’s hardships and shared memories from the past bring together parallel ‘worlds’of protagonists in a city, where melancholy lingers and humor is the only respite. This film integrates portraits of people, who refuse to accept the present, and live with nostalgia for the past, as mutual common trauma is still alive.

The film reveals a little-known story of the Russian army's foreign campaigns of 1813-1814, which tells about the completion of the defeat of Napoleon's army and the liberation of the countries of Western Europe from the French conquerors. After more than 200 years, the inhabitants of the modern Netherlands remember the exploits of the Russian army and carefully preserve the common history.

He was born in a country that was still subordinate to Qing China, saw the formation of the young state of the Tuva People's Republic, witnessed how a small republic became part of the vast country of the USSR. The film is dedicated to the 120th anniversary of the birth of the folk craftsman, woodcarver, master-maker of national musical instruments of the Republic of Tuva Dongak Okaanchik (Okanchyk).

Moscow musician, church bell ringer Filipp Gorbachev travels through the provinces of Russia, exploring the nature of bell ringing. On the way, he finds an empty cathedral, within the walls of which, in prayer, he tunes in to a new musical improvisation. Asceticism and flight from the mundane open up a new sound reality of modern Christianity. The bell is the only musical instrument used in Orthodox worship, and its connection with the spiritual culture of Russia is incredibly strong. In 2016, the famous techno producer and DJ Filipp Gorbachev was trained by the master of bell ringing, subsequently becoming the bell ringer of the Church of St. Nicholas in Aksinino. Such an interest in Orthodox culture is not accidental, having experienced the influence of Peter Mamonov, the Moscow electronic musician believes in the special spirituality of the Russian dance floor. This film is an attempt to reflect it through the prayerful experience of a modern bell ringer, under whose monastic cassock hides a mechanic's red overalls, Gorbachev's usual stage attire. Following Philip, the camera, attentive to details, tries to find and capture that fragile atmosphere in which the sound of bells becomes a source of divine revelation and turns people into brothers and sisters.
